Understanding Window Defogging: A Comprehensive Guide
Window defogging is a typical yet often overlooked element of maintaining homes, specifically in areas subjected to substantial temperature level variations. Foggy windows can be an annoyance, obscuring views and triggering pain within the home. This article will explore the causes of window fogging, methods for defogging, preventative procedures, and regularly asked concerns to boost your understanding of this concern.
Causes of Window Fogging
Window fogging occurs when warm, wet air comes into contact with a cooler surface, triggering condensation. Here are some primary aspects contributing to foggy windows:
- Humidity Levels: High indoor humidity, particularly in cooking areas and bathrooms, can cause condensation on windows.
- Temperature Variation: Extreme temperature level distinctions between indoor and outdoor environments heighten the danger of window fogging.
- Poor Ventilation: Inadequate air flow can increase humidity levels inside homes, leading to foggy windows.
- Insulated Windows: Although double or triple-paned windows are developed to prevent condensation, seals can deteriorate, triggering wetness to penetrate the space between the panes.

Techniques for Defogging Windows
When windows begin to fog, several techniques can be utilized to clear the view. Here are some reliable techniques for defogging windows:
1. Utilizing a Dehumidifier
A dehumidifier can significantly minimize indoor humidity, which subsequently reduces fogging throughout durations of high moisture.

2. Ventilation and Air Circulation
Improving air flow in your home can help avoid condensation. Make use of exhaust fans in cooking areas and bathrooms, and think about opening windows on dry days for better ventilation.
3. Anti-Fog Solutions
Specialty anti-fog spray items can develop an undetectable barrier on the window, avoiding wetness from forming.
4. Heat Sources
Increasing the temperature of the air around the windows can assist vaporize condensation. Use space heaters or change your thermostat to combat fogging.
5. Cleansing Products
Utilizing vinegar and water or commercial window cleaners can help get rid of existing fog and prevent wetness accumulation.

6. Insulating Window Treatments
Thermal drapes or window films can help maintain temperature level differences and decrease the probability of fogging.
7. Desiccants
Putting desiccant packs (silica gel) near fog-prone windows can help absorb excess wetness in the air.

Q2: Can defogging services be utilized on all window types?A2: Most defogging options are safe for glass surfaces, however it's best to follow the producer's guidelines for specific treatments as some might not be appropriate for special coatings. Q3: Are there long-lasting services to avoid window fogging?A3: Installing insulated windows, ensuring correct ventilation, and handling indoor humidity levels work long-term methods to avoid window fogging. Q4: How often should a dehumidifier be utilized?A4: The frequency of dehumidifier use depends on indoor humidity levels. It ought to be utilized constantly throughout humid months and only when needed in drier seasons. Q5: Do I need professional aid for window misting concerns?A5: If fogging continues in spite of attempting different methods, it may be suggested to speak with experts, particularly if there is a problem with Residential Window Repair seals or insulation.
